> > Fails to build on OSX
> 
> Also fails to build on AArch64 Linux:

OK, I see why I missed this.
My two weirder build cases I checked with previously were building on RHEL6 (that's
too old for userfault) and an ARM box.  However, the tests include the headers from
qemu's linux-header/ subdirectory and that includes __NR_userfault for
both x86 and 32bit ARM, so I wasn't hitting the other side of the ifdef
in my testing.
